Structural engineer services involve evaluating the integrity and safety of a building’s framework. These professionals assess how different parts of a property, such as foundations, beams, and load-bearing walls, support the structure as a whole. When homeowners notice signs of potential issues-like cracks in walls, uneven floors, or sagging ceilings-hiring a structural engineer can help determine whether these problems stem from structural weaknesses or other causes. Their detailed analysis ensures that any necessary repairs or reinforcements are properly designed to maintain the safety and stability of the property.

This service is essential for addressing a variety of common problems that can threaten the stability of a home. For instance, if a property has experienced foundation settling, water damage, or shifting soil, a structural engineer can identify the root causes and recommend effective solutions. They also assist in evaluating the impact of renovations or additions, ensuring that new construction does not compromise existing structural elements. In cases of damage from natural events or accidents, a structural assessment can provide clarity on the extent of repairs needed and help prevent future issues.

Structural engineer services are frequently sought for residential properties, including single-family homes, townhouses, and multi-family buildings. Homeowners planning major renovations or additions often turn to these professionals to ensure their plans are structurally sound. Older homes with signs of deterioration or settlement also benefit from a structural evaluation to address potential safety concerns. Additionally, properties located in areas prone to shifting soil or heavy rainfall may require assessments to confirm that their foundations and load-bearing elements are adequate to withstand local conditions.

The overview below groups typical Structural Engineer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ooltewah, TN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For minor assessments like crack evaluations or small structural modifications,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, with fewer projects reaching higher costs.

Moderate Projects - Mid-sized projects such as foundation assessments or adding support structures usually cost between $600 and $2,000. These are common for residential properties and tend to be within this typical range.

Large or Complex Jobs - Larger projects like detailed structural analysis or extensive reinforcement work can range from $2,000 to $5,000+. Such projects are less frequent but necessary for significant structural concerns.

Full Structural Replacement - Complete replacement or major overhaul of a structure may exceed $5,000, with costs depending on size and complexity. These are less common but handled by specialized service providers in the area.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
